| Laboring | p. pr. & vb. n. | of Labor |
| Laboring | a. | That labors; performing labor; esp., performing coarse, heavy work, not requiring skill also, set apart for labor; as, laboring days. |
| Laboring | a. | Suffering pain or grief. |
